Automatiser le regroupement de 3 fichiers Excel en 1 seul

Bonjour

Voila , j'ai sur le partage, 3 fichiers qui ce nomme Chantier 1.xls, Chantier 2.xls et Chantier 3.xls , ils sont alimentés toute la journée par des personnes différentes de mon service

A la fin de la journée , et pour éviter d'ouvrir ces 3 fichiers pour récupération des données , j'aimerais que sur un 4 eme fichier qui s'appelle RECAP COMMANDES CHANTIERS.xls, l'ensemble des 3 fichier remontent en automatique sans écraser l'historique

Qulelqu'un peut m'aider car je suis novice dans

Clément

9chantier-1.zip (91.02 Ko)
10chantier-2.zip (91.01 Ko)
8chantier-3.zip (91.02 Ko)

Bonjour

ci joint une proposition

Attention

  • nous n'avons pas les mêmes version d'excel
  • j'ai supprimé la fusion des colonnes B et C et agrandi B. Si C correspondait à une quantité insérer une colonne avec l'intitulé Quant. Les colonnes fusionnées sont sources de pb dans les recopies
  • le formatage des différentes colonnes ( Droite, Centre etc) doit être identiques entre les 4 fichiers

Les 4 fichiers sont à mettre dans un mémé dossier où alors avoir le chemin critique de chacun

Ci joint les 4 fichiers

A tester avec le Bouton

Cordialement

FINDRH

13chantier-1.zip (91.16 Ko)
8chantier-2.zip (91.20 Ko)
17chantier-3.zip (91.15 Ko)

Bonjour merci pour votre aide,

j'ai changé quelque noms des colonnes et j'ai respecté la mise en forme dans chaque fichiers, cela me met "erreur execution "1004"

est ce que tu pourrais me débugger mon fichier ?

autre dernière question, comment je fais lorsque je veux ajouter un chantier 4 ? qu'est ce que je dois rajouter dans la macro ?

Merci grandement pour ton aide

Clément

11chantier-1.zip (89.33 Ko)
11chantier-2.zip (91.33 Ko)
12chantier-3.zip (91.25 Ko)

Bonjour

ci joint la macro corrigée.

Pour augmenter le nb de chantiers il suffit :

  • créer les fichiers avec la même syntaxe Chantier 4.xls
  • aller dans le module Import
  • modifier la ligne suivante;
For i = 1 To 3 ==> 3 remplacé par 4, ce chiffre est le nb de fichiers et le rang du dernier fichier

A tester

Question:

le fichier Recap est il quotidien ou cumulatif ? S'il est quotidien on peut le garder vierge et l'enregistrer sous avec la date.

Par contre son nom me semble trop long.... tu peux le changer sans que cela affecte la macro

Les fichiers chantiers sont ils quotidiens ?

Quelle version d'excel as tu ?

Cordialement

FINDRH

Rechercher des sujets similaires à "automatiser regroupement fichiers seul"